My Medicine

I've broken all my mirrors, i hate the person i see.
Family aren't the only ones, who miss who i used to be.
the shell of a lonely creature, locked behind traps & walls.
I'm screaming out for help, but no one ever hears me call.
This is no life for me, I'm giving up on hiding.
You want to get to know the REAL me? he lives through my writings.
There may no be a purpose for this, these words may all be in vain.
But your love is the only medication, that can cure me of this pain.
